Ameygroupi is looking for a Cleaner/Housekeeper for Dumfries and Galloway Schools at St Andrews RC Primary School. The position offers 15 hours of work per week with a pay rate of £13.45 per hour.

Responsibilities include providing a high-quality cleaning service and ensuring compliance with health and safety regulations.

The ideal candidate will have:

  • Excellent attention to detail
  • Strong customer service skills
  • A commitment to safety while using materials and machinery

Opportunities for career growth and training are available.
